This is a religious procession in the Judaism which symbolizes the covenant between God and the Children of Israel. The Circumcision is performed in the eighth day of the child's life, by a 'mohel', a circumciser, who appears in the center of the image, in profile. This one wears an overall, for hygiene reasons. As we can see in the picture, all the family takes part to the ritual. The man who holds the child on his knee during the ceremony is called the 'Sandaq' (godfather). He wears the 'tallit' (prayer shawl) and we can suppose that he is the child's paternal or maternal grandfather, as it is usually the case. The child's father is probably the man dressed with a dark suit, who helps the Sandak hold the baby. The child's mother stands in the foreground, before the Sandak, as all the women do.
